Output 32cdcc0eb6c79fe023b83880eed754a7376b9497688211223c635b931926c113:12

value
507903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da70f26c38c08cf2991741d7ab46b42b4128dd1 OP_EQUAL
address
3LSQaLwjVe2xAAvTad1EmwfHDbzeZh1Rvp
transaction
32cdcc0eb6c79fe023b83880eed754a7376b9497688211223c635b931926c113
spent
true